The Shops in The Square in the 1960s

The Shops in The Square in the 1960s

This photograph shows the line of shops that once sat between the corner of Broadway Avenue and the Square through to Main Street East. Visible are: Gerrands; Deluxe Shoes; Radio and Electric House; Manhattan Ltd; Coopers for Shoes; The Farmers. Apart from the building on the far left, these buildings are all still standing (2014).Further down on the corner of Main Street East and The Square is the old Post Office. The opposite corner is the Public Library. The old library building is now the Square Centre - housing office space and a cafe. The City Library moved to its current home in the old CM Ross building in 1996.
